A traffic collision on State Route 60 East in Moreno Valley, CA, has caused significant traffic disruptions today. The incident, which involved two vehicles—a Toyota and a black semi-truck with silver trailer lights—occurred around 6:29 PM. Both vehicles came to a stop on the right-hand side of the road, leading to lane closures and delays on the highway and the Gilman Springs Road off-ramp.
Emergency services responded promptly to manage the scene and coordinate the removal of the vehicles. A tow truck was called to assist with clearing both the Toyota and the semi-truck. As a result of the collision, motorists faced considerable backup and congestion in the area, particularly during the evening commute.
